Job Description

Baker Tilly has an incredible career opportunity for a program/project manager to join our growing Digital Consulting team. Baker Tilly’s Digital Consulting Practice combines deep functional, industry, and technical capabilities to help clients solve their toughest enterprise digital challenges. Baker Tilly Digital is focused on the integration of advanced technologies with core business transformational services to support companies in successfully navigating the complexities of digital transformations.

What You Will Do
  • Lead a team of Baker Tilly and client resources through definition and delivery of transformation projects which may include business process and/or technology implementations
  • Develop, manage, and measure effectiveness of project approach and plans aligned to critical phases of implementation (analyze, design, build, test, deploy) and/or long-term roadmaps which describe delivering large-scale solutions via a series of projects
  • Elicit and define requirements using multiple methods such as interviews, document analysis, workshops, surveys, site visits, etc.
  • Manage and implement multiple projects through delegation, coordination, communication, and organization.
  • Coordinate deployment of projects included staffing resources, deadlines, and end user expectations
  • Ensure that all projects are properly documented, which includes a business case, business requirements, and implementation plan, maintaining document requirements for project managers and business owners
  • Manage third party vendor relationships to resource specific development needs
  • Act as the liaison among the executive committee members, stakeholders, and development team including identification and mitigation of project risks and issues
  • Support the development of the Enterprise Transformation practice from go-to-market activities to delivery methodology standards and team development
  • Provide functional expertise based on your specific skills and background
  • Utilize your entrepreneurial skills to network and build strong relationships internally and externally with clients and the community
  • Invest in your professional development individually and through participation in firm wide learning and development programs
  • Support the growth and development of team members and clients through the Baker Tilly Value Architect model, helping associates meet their professional goals
  • Enjoy friendships, social activities and team outings that encourage a work-life balance
Successful candidates will have
  • Bachelor’s degree in relevant field
  • Minimum of five (5) years of related experience; previous related industry and consulting experience highly preferred
  • Experience managing senior-level client relationships and working across an organization with multiple stakeholders
  • Ability to lead and supervise others, provide exceptional client service, see the \"big picture\" as well as the details, display appropriate ethical knowledge, and exhibit a sense of urgency and commitment to quality and the timely completion of projects
  • Ability to decompose scope into detailed activities and deliverables, then conduct work package handoff to delivery resources from Baker Tilly, client teams, and third-party vendors
  • Ability to manage multiple projects/initiatives simultaneously, with a willingness to support different workstreams as needed
  • Ability to think creatively to solve problems gained through prior experience, education, training to resolve issues and remove project obstacles
  • Demonstrated management, analytical, organization, interpersonal, project management, communication, and highly developed Microsoft Suite (Word, Excel, PowerPoint) skills
  • Project experience with full lifecycle application development (e.g. requirements gathering, use case development, system analysis and design, integration, testing, deployment)
  • Experience with Agile software delivery management tools and techniques (Scrum, JIRA, confluence) is a plus
  • Project/program management certification (e.g. PMP, PgMP) and/or Agile certification (e.g. PMI-ACP, CSM, PSM. SAFe POPM) is a plus
  • Ability to travel as needed, up to 100% at times depending on the client, and work outside of core business hours for client engagements
